This review is from: The Upside of the Downside (Audio CD)
This album feels like a glimpse inside the mind and soul of someone who is part stranger, part friend, and part mirror. Imaginary Johnny combines music with sensitive vocals and thoughtful lyrics to gently illustrate moments and emotions that seem strangely familiar. Every track is sing-along-able, and there is no low spot to the album. "I Forgot My Wallet" is my personal favorite track. The repeated, impassioned declaration of "I don't ever want to need anyone that much again" is a serious emotional punch. Basically, this is genius. I am excitedly awaiting his next effort. I enjoyed this CD the first time I heard it, and it only gets better and better with further listening. It has quickly become one of my all-time favorites, and I absolutely recommend it.
